Overflowing Toilets offers an emergency plumbing service that manages crises involving toilet backups and flooding. Technicians assess causes such as clogs, faulty fill valves, or sewer line issues, and apply sanitation and repair methods to reestablish function. This service is essential for maintaining hygiene and preventing water damage
